Summary
The aim of this interventional study is to assess the effect of the single high dose of
vitamin D on its serum metabolites in elderly.
The main questions it attempts to answer is:
1. what is the effect of a single, high, oral dose of vitamin D3 (120,000 IU) on serum
25(OH)D3, 25(OH)D2, 24,25(OH)2D3, 3-epi-25(OH)D3, 1,25(OH)2D3, 24,25(OH)2D3/25(OH)D3
ratio, and 25(OH)D3/3-epi-25(OH)D3 ratio concentration at baseline, 3 days and 7 days
after administration, compared to control group.
2. what is the influence of percentage of fat tissue on serum metabolites of vitamin D and
their changes after bolus dose, compared to control group.
